Aer Lingus back in Copenhagen
Aer Lingus has reopened a Copenhagen to Dublin service, with four weekly flights (Mondays, Wednesdays, Fridays and Sundays) leaving Copenhagen at 11.20 and arriving in Dublin at 12.35.
Aer Lingus has previously operated between Copenhagen and Dublin, but closed down the service in March 2000.
Reacting to increased competition from low-cost airlines on the UK and Irish markets, Aer Lingus has increased its efficiency and lowered costs, which translates into lower fares for passengers.
